Specializing solely in AI, C3.ai helps big businesses apply AI in industries such as energy, defense, manufacturing, and more. The company creates user-friendly platforms that allow clients to develop and run AI applications without starting from scratch [1].

Palantir builds data analysis software that empowers governments and businesses to make wise decisions using AI and big data. Palantir caters to various sectors, including military and law enforcement agencies, financial institutions, and healthcare companies [1].

Business Basics

Despite not being a direct AI player, Snowflake offers essential infrastructure required for AI. Snowflake assists companies in storing and managing vast amounts of data in the cloud, a crucial ingredient in nurturing AI systems [1].

The Runway Ahead

As a leading cloud data platform, Snowflake is poised for growth as more companies migrate their data to the cloud [1]. Reasons to rejoice: Snowflake's self-service model allows companies to move data and develop AI tools without having to manage servers themselves [1].

Warning Signs

Competition is fierce - cloud providers like Amazon (AWS), Microsoft (Azure), and Google (Cloud) also offer similar services [1]. Additionally, Snowflake spends heavily on expanding services, potentially affecting short-term profits [1].
